Emerging Trends and Disruptive Technologies Reshaping Calcium Plastic Turnover from Raw Material Sourcing to End Use Applications Worldwide
Over the past decade, groundbreaking advancements in material engineering and processing technologies have redefined the calcium plastic turnover landscape. High-performance reactor systems now enable precise control of particle size distribution and filler dispersion, resulting in polymers that exhibit both superior mechanical properties and enhanced processability. Concurrently, digital twin platforms and real-time analytics have streamlined development cycles, allowing R&D teams to iterate prototype formulations more rapidly and with greater confidence.Furthermore, the emergence of bio-derived calcium carbonate precursors has introduced new opportunities for fully bio-integrated solutions. These novel feedstocks, derived from agricultural byproducts and industrial waste streams, are transforming the narrative around sustainability, offering a two-fold benefit of reducing waste and minimizing reliance on finite mineral deposits. As innovations in additive manufacturing gain traction, calcium plastic composites are also proving compatible with 3D printing technologies, opening avenues for lightweight structural components in automotive interiors and specialized healthcare devices.
In addition, cross-industry collaborations are fostering standardized sustainability metrics and certification pathways, which are critical for ensuring material traceability and consumer trust. As companies align on common definitions around recyclability and eco-design, the landscape is shifting toward a more transparent value chain. This convergence of technological progress, circular economy initiatives, and regulatory harmonization is accelerating the transition to next-generation calcium plastic turnover models that balance performance, cost, and environmental stewardship.

Unveiling Critical Market Segmentation Drivers Across Product Types, Materials, End Use Industries, and Distribution Channels to Inform Strategic Decisions
A nuanced understanding of product type segmentation reveals that single compartment solutions remain foundational for simple packaging applications, while multi compartment systems are gaining traction in specialized food and healthcare contexts. Horizontal stackable designs dominate bulk storage scenarios, but innovations in vertical stackable configurations are responding to space constraints in urban distribution centers. Simultaneously, single use and reusable disposable formats are evolving to address both hygiene requirements and sustainability goals, driving divergent R&D pathways among industry participants.Material segmentation yields equally compelling insights, particularly as bio based variants such as PHA and PLA advance toward commercial viability. Homopolymer polypropylene continues to deliver favorable cost-to-performance ratios, while copolymer alternatives are being formulated for enhanced impact resistance. Recycled HDPE and low melt LDPE grades are increasingly leveraged for lower energy processing, and rigid PVC remains integral for applications demanding high dimensional stability. These material choices are informed by processing constraints, end-use specifications, and environmental compliance requirements.
End use industry segmentation highlights robust growth in automotive interior components, where calcium plastic composites contribute to lightweighting strategies. Beverage and dairy packaging benefit from improved barrier properties and regulatory approvals, while diagnostic and labware applications capitalize on enhanced chemical resistance. In cosmetics and personal care, formulations tailored for skin contact and product safety are gaining accelerated adoption. Across each vertical, the interplay between product design and material attributes underscores the importance of holistic segmentation for strategic planning.
